/* CSS Document */
/* Style sheet designed from "Build a Better Website" Summer_Fall 2008
    Putting CSS into practice - pp. 70-79 (and beyond)  BT-08/06/2009  */
	



#container  {
	width: 960px;
	margin-right: auto;
	margin-left: auto;
	text-align: left;
	background-color:#FFFFFF;
	
	padding: 5px;
	
}

body {
	text-align: center;
	background-color: #9EC7A0;
	
}



#header {
background-color:#bfeaaa;
background-color:#999933;
}




#menu {
	float: left;
	width: 150px;
	margin-right: 10px;
	clear:both;
	padding-left: 10px;

/* Added Oct 3,09 */

 color:#666;
   font-size:x-small;
   line-height:1.2em;
   list-style-type:disc;


}




/*               */



#widemenu {
	background-color:#dddddd;
	margin-bottom: 10px;
	height: 25px;
	
}

#widemenu ul li{
	float: left;
	list-style-type:none;
	padding: 5px 30px 5px 5px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	font-size: 14px;
			
}


#widemenu ul {
	margin: 0px;
	padding: 0px;
	
}


#widemenu ul li a {
	color:#000000;
	text-decoration:none;
	
}


#widemenu ul li a:hover {
	color: #990000;
}




/* Added Styles ~ 20Nov2015  */

#widemenu2 {
	background-color:#dddddd;
	margin-bottom: 10px;
	height: 25px;
	
}

#widemenu2 ul li{
	float: left;
	list-style-type:none;
	padding: 5px 30px 5px 5px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	font-size: 14px;
			
}


#widemenu2 ul {
	margin: 0px;
	padding: 0px;
	
}


#widemenu2 ul li a {
	color:#000000;
	text-decoration:none;
	
}


#widemenu2 ul li a:hover {
	color: #990000;
}



#widemenu2 div {background-color: green;}
#widemenu2 div a {
    text-decoration: none;
    color: white;
    font-size: 20px;
    padding: 15px;
    display:inline-block;
}
#widemenu2 ul {
  display: inline;
  margin: 0;
  padding: 0;
}
#widemenu2 ul li {display: inline-block;}
#widemenu2 ul li:hover {background: #555;
background:#999933;
}

#widemenu2 ul li:hover ul {display: block;}
#widemenu2 ul li ul {
  position: absolute;
  width: 200px;
  display: none;
}
#widemenu2 ul li ul li { 
  background: #555;
  background:#999933; 
  display: block; 
}
#widemenu2 ul li ul li a {display:block !important;} 
#widemenu2 ul li ul li:hover {background: #666;
}

/** Added p element too **/
#widemenu2 p {
background: #999933; 
display: block;

}







/* *******************  */





#content  {
	float: left;
	width: 560px;
	background-image:url(../images/khaki.gif);
	padding: 15px;
	background-repeat: repeat-x;
	/*	background-color:#996600;  */
	
	background-color:#EAEAD5;	
}

#sidebar {
	float: right;
	width: 180px;
	padding-bottom: 10px;
	padding-left:20px;
	font-family:Arial, Helvetica, sans-serif;
	font-size: 80%;
}

#footer_retire_aug09 {
	border-top: 1px solid #000000;
	clear: both;
	margin-left: 160px;
	padding-top: 10px;
	
}
	
	
#footer {
	clear: both;
	background: #dddddd;
	/* color: #CCCC66;   */
	
	
	
	padding: 5px 10px;
	text-align: right;
	font-size: 80%;

}

#footer_email {
color:#660000;
}


.pullquote {
font:Arial, Helvetica, sans-serif;
color: #666666;
width: 120px;
margin: 10px 0px 10px 10px;
padding: 5px;
border-bottom: 2px solid #666666;
border-top: 2px solid #666666;
float: right;

}


.narrator   {

}


div.mmhide_toc{
   background-color:#fff;
   padding:1ex;
   width:33%;
   float:right;}
#toccnt{
   background-color:#eed;
   padding:0 0 2px .5ex;
   border:1px solid #ccc;}
#toccnt ul{
   padding:0;
   margin:.5ex .1ex 0 1.25em;}
#toccnt ul li{
   color:#666;
   font-size:x-small;
   line-height:1.2em;
   list-style-type:disc;}
#toccnt ul li a{
   color:#333;
   text-decoration:none;}
#toccnt ul li a:hover{
   text-decoration:underline;}


/* Added Styles on Mom's Birthday ~ 13Dec2014-BT    */


li.headlink ul { display: none; }
       li.headlink:hover ul { display: block; }
	   
	   
/* Added Styles on Bob's Birthday ~ 8Apr2015-BT    */	   
	  

.picture { background-color: #F9F9F9;
border: 1px solid #CCCCCC; padding: 3px;
font: 11px/1.4em Arial, sans-serif; }
.picture img { border: 1px solid #CCCCCC;
vertical-align:middle; margin-bottom: 3px; }
.right { margin: 0.5em 0pt 0.5em 0.8em; float:right; }
.left { margin: 0.5em 0.8em 0.5em 0; float:left; }


/* Added Styles ~ 8Jun2015  */

aside {
  float: right;
  position:relative;
}


/* *******************  */

/* Added Styles ~ 1Nov2015  */

a.newMenuLink { color: #FF3300;
font-style:italic;

 }


/* *******************  */


/* Added Styles ~ 20Nov2015  */

.nav_dropdown_orginal div {background-color: green;}
.nav_dropdown_orginal div a {
    text-decoration: none;
    color: white;
    font-size: 20px;
    padding: 15px;
    display:inline-block;
}
.nav_dropdown_orginal ul {
  display: inline;
  margin: 0;
  padding: 0;
}
.nav_dropdown_orginal ul li {display: inline-block;}
.nav_dropdown_orginal ul li:hover {background: #555;}
.nav_dropdown_orginal ul li:hover ul {display: block;}
.nav_dropdown_orginal ul li ul {
  position: absolute;
  width: 200px;
  display: none;
}
.nav_dropdown_orginal ul li ul li { 
  background: #555; 
  display: block; 
}
.nav_dropdown_orginal ul li ul li a {display:block !important;} 
.nav_dropdown_orginal ul li ul li:hover {background: #666;}

/* *******************  */